ALSA: hda - Restore default pin configs for realtek codecs

Some machines have broken BIOS resume that doesn't restore the default
pin configuration properly, which results in a wrong detection of HP
pin.  This causes a silent speaker output due to missing HP detection.
Related bug: Novell bug#406101
	https://bugzilla.novell.com/show_bug.cgi?id=406101

This patch fixes the issue by saving/restoring the default pin configs
by the driver itself.

#ifdef SND_HDA_NEEDS_RESUME
static void store_pin_configs(struct hda_codec *codec)
{
struct alc_spec *spec = codec->spec;
hda_nid_t nid, end_nid;
end_nid = codec->start_nid + codec->num_nodes;
for (nid = codec->start_nid; nid < end_nid; nid++) {
unsigned int wid_caps = get_wcaps(codec, nid);
unsigned int wid_type =
(wid_caps & AC_WCAP_TYPE) >> AC_WCAP_TYPE_SHIFT;
if (wid_type != AC_WID_PIN)
continue;
if (spec->num_pins >= ARRAY_SIZE(spec->pin_nids))
break;
spec->pin_nids[spec->num_pins] = nid;
spec->pin_cfgs[spec->num_pins] =
snd_hda_codec_read(codec, nid, 0,
AC_VERB_GET_CONFIG_DEFAULT, 0);
spec->num_pins++;
}
}
static void resume_pin_configs(struct hda_codec *codec)
{
struct alc_spec *spec = codec->spec;
int i;
for (i = 0; i < spec->num_pins; i++) {
hda_nid_t pin_nid = spec->pin_nids[i];
unsigned int pin_config = spec->pin_cfgs[i];
snd_hda_codec_write(codec, pin_nid, 0,
AC_VERB_SET_CONFIG_DEFAULT_BYTES_0,
pin_config & 0x000000ff);
snd_hda_codec_write(codec, pin_nid, 0,
AC_VERB_SET_CONFIG_DEFAULT_BYTES_1,
(pin_config & 0x0000ff00) >> 8);
snd_hda_codec_write(codec, pin_nid, 0,
AC_VERB_SET_CONFIG_DEFAULT_BYTES_2,
(pin_config & 0x00ff0000) >> 16);
snd_hda_codec_write(codec, pin_nid, 0,
AC_VERB_SET_CONFIG_DEFAULT_BYTES_3,
pin_config >> 24);
}
}
static int alc_resume(struct hda_codec *codec)
{
resume_pin_configs(codec);
codec->patch_ops.init(codec);
snd_hda_codec_resume_amp(codec);
snd_hda_codec_resume_cache(codec);
return 0;
}
#else
#define store_pin_configs(codec)
#endif
